Scope/Content: Abstract: FERC issued docket number p-20:PacifiCorp commissioned Kleinfelder, Inc, of Taylorsville, Utah, to conduct a geo-seismic evaluation for the Grace Dam location. This work included the tabulation of Quaternary seismic sources identified by the United States Geological Survey, an inventory of historic seismicity, a general site reconnaissance of the dam location, an assessment of probabilistic earthquake parameters, and estimation of the maximum credible and operating basis earthquakes.
